AI-Enhanced Insights

Gibb River Airport is a remote airstrip located in the Kimberley region of Western Australia, serving the rugged Gibb River Road corridor. It primarily supports tourism access to remote cattle stations, national parks, and wilderness areas in one of Australia's most isolated landscapes. The small airport provides a vital connection for travelers exploring the ancient gorges, dramatic landscapes, and Indigenous cultural sites of the East Kimberley.

🚖 Getting There

A high-clearance 4WD vehicle is essential for traveling around the Gibb River region, as roads are unpaved and often rough. Charter flights are the most practical way to reach the airport, as there is no public transport servicing this remote location. Visitors should carry extra fuel, water, and supplies, as distances between services can exceed 100 kilometers.
